Crispy Polenta Chips GF

Ingredients

45 piece(s)

  • 40 g Parmesan cheese, cut into 2cm cubes
  • 4 sprigs Fresh herbs, Rosemary, Thyme, leaves only
  • 1 litre water
  • 2 tablespoons chicken stock, EDC
  • 50 g Butter
  • 250 g polenta

Recipe's preparation

  1. Place parmesan and fresh herbs into TM bowl 20 secs / Speed 8

    Lightly brush 20 x 30 cm pann with oil and sprinkle with cheese and herbs.

    Put water and stock into TM bowl and cook 11 min / 90 degrees / Speed 4

    After 3 minutes, slowly add polenta through the lid.

    Spoon into prepared pan and allow to cool, set in fridge.

     

    Preheat Oven to 220 degrees celcius. 

    Cut Polenta into 2 cm x 10 cm fingers and place on tray.  Brush with oil.

     

    Bake 20 - 25 minutes until golden crisp.
